#575607 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#575607 is composed of 34.1% red, 33.7% green and 2.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 1.1% magenta, 92% yellow and 65.9% black. It has a hue angle of 59.3 degrees, a saturation of 85.1% and a lightness of 18.4%. #575607 color hex could be obtained by blending #aeac0e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666600.

Shades and Tints of #575607

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0e01 is the darkest color, while #fffffb is the lightest one.

Tones of #575607

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2f2f2f is the less saturated color, while #5b5a03 is the most saturated one.
